Local privilege escalation via unchecked display buffer
Published Jan 2, 2024 · Updated Apr 17, 2025
Memory corruption in MediaTek display DRM on listed Android 12.0 and 13.0 chipsets allows local users to escalate privileges. The display DRM component processes data without a required bounds check, permitting memory corruption outside the intended buffer. Exploitation is local, requires existing System execution privileges, and needs no user interaction; successful exploitation grants elevated execution.
